Nobuhito
信仁, 伸仁, 延人, 宣仁, 暢仁, 順仁, 敦仁, 睦仁, 敬仁, 崇仁(Nobuhito)
Pronunciation: noh-boo-hee-toh
Meaning
trustworthy, virtuous, benevolent person
Origin
Japanese

Famous People Named Nobuhito
- Prince Nobuhito Takamatsu (1905-1987), a member of the Japanese Imperial Family, the third son of Emperor Taishō and Empress Teimei.
- Nobuhito Obayashi (born 1938), a Japanese film director, screenwriter, and editor.
- Nobuhito Kashiwabara (born 1968), a Japanese actor.
- Nobuhito Sato (born 1967), a Japanese former professional baseball player.
